Northwest 6 is one of the original DC boundary stones, laid down in 1791-1792 by Andrew Ellicott, Benjamin Banneker, and others to mark every mile of the boundary of the federal territory of the District of Columbia and Maryland. This stone now lies in a small meadow with a memorial plaque, and is caged (to keep it from getting loose I guess). The cache is among the nearby trees.
